/* This file should never be included directly but, rather,
* only indirectly through nuttx/irq.h
*/
#ifndef __ARCH_ARM_INCLUDE_IMX9_IRQ_H
#define __ARCH_ARM_INCLUDE_IMX9_IRQ_H
/****************************************************************************
* Included Files
****************************************************************************/
#include <nuttx/config.h>
#if defined(CONFIG_ARCH_CHIP_IMX95_M7)
# include <arch/imx9/imx95_irq.h>
#else
# error "Unrecognized i.MX9 architecture"
#endif
/****************************************************************************
* Pre-processor Definitions
****************************************************************************/
/* IRQ numbers. The IRQ number corresponds vector number and hence map
* directly to bits in the NVIC. This does, however, waste several words
* of memory in the IRQ to handle mapping tables.
*/
/* Common Processor Exceptions (vectors 0-15) */
#define IMX9_IRQ_RESERVED (0) /* Reserved vector .. only used with
* CONFIG_DEBUG_FEATURES */
/* Vector 0: Reset stack pointer value */
/* Vector 1: Reset(not handled by IRQ) */
#define IMX9_IRQ_NMI (2) /* Vector 2: Non-Maskable Int (NMI) */
#define IMX9_IRQ_HARDFAULT (3) /* Vector 3: Hard fault */
#define IMX9_IRQ_MEMFAULT (4) /* Vector 4: Memory management (MPU) */
#define IMX9_IRQ_BUSFAULT (5) /* Vector 5: Bus fault */
#define IMX9_IRQ_USAGEFAULT (6) /* Vector 6: Usage fault */
/* Vectors 7-10: Reserved */
#define IMX9_IRQ_SVCALL (11) /* Vector 11: SVC call */
#define IMX9_IRQ_DBGMONITOR (12) /* Vector 12: Debug Monitor */
/* Vector 13: Reserved */
#define IMX9_IRQ_PENDSV (14) /* Vector 14: Pendable SSR */
#define IMX9_IRQ_SYSTICK (15) /* Vector 15: System tick */
/* Chip-Specific External interrupts */
#define IMX9_IRQ_EXTINT (16) /* Vector number of the first ext int */
#define ARMV7M_PERIPHERAL_INTERRUPTS IMX9_IRQ_NEXTINT
#endif /* __ARCH_ARM_INCLUDE_IMX9_IRQ_H */
